You will need to learn (right away) how to type special characters like the accent marks and special punctuation ¡¿. There are many different ways to do this and which is best depends on several factors - what program you're using, what type of computer you have, how often you'll actually need them, etc. SpanishDict.com's How to type Spanish Accents and Letters page has a pretty good explanation of common ways to handle these characters.
For quizzes you'll take here on Sakai, I will put a set of characters on the quiz page itself that you can copy and paste. There is also always the Insert Symbol function Ω in the Sakai text editor that you can use. I, personally, use the ALT codes or set my keyboard to Spanish when I type in Sakai, but I've had lots of practice with them so they're pretty second-nature by now. If you expect to need to type in Spanish in the future, it's worth learning to use the codes, or learn the Spanish layout on your keyboard.
